linux关于任务计划
2024-08-24 01:06:59
1.一次性任务计划:at
1)添加 在18:16时候重启服务器
at 18:16
>at init 6
>at ctrl+d
2)查看
atq
1 Mon Aug 20 21:09:00 2018 a root(job号是1 ...)
3)删除
atrm 1 #删除job号为1的job
2.周期性任务计划:crontab
1)添加
crontab -e #进入编辑任务计划
30 23 * * 6 /sbin/init 6 #每周六晚上23:30重启服务器
00 01 * * 0 /sbin/init 6 #每周日凌晨01:30重启服务器
2)查看
crontab -l #查看任务计划
3)删除
crontab -r #删除该用户的全部任务计划
crontab -e #单独编辑删除
* * * * * 分 时 日 月 周
00 03 * * * 每天凌晨三点
30 23 * * * 每天23:30
*/5 * * * * 每隔五分钟
59 23 * * 1-5 周一到周五23:59
59 23 * * 1,3,5 周一、周三、周五的23:59
任务计划的应用:
shell脚本:
#备份静态资源的shell脚本
1)写脚本
cd
touch backup.sh
#!/bin/bash
t=`date +%Y.%m.%d`;
f="pic-${t}.zip";
cd /opt/web/
zip -r $f * &>/dev/null
mv $f /mnt
2)任务计划
crontab -e
30 23 * * 6 /root/backup.sh
3)查看
cd /mnt
ll
最新文章
- 【转】Controllers and Routers in ASP.NET MVC 3
- 互联网+下PDA移动智能手持POS超市收银开单软件
- JS判断是否为安卓orIOS
- Title Case
- 生成dll文件的示例
- python学习笔记:python序列
- xcode KVC:Key Value Coding 键值编码
- C# QQ &; 163 邮件发送
- Mysql优化--Show Profile
- 【IOS 开发】Object - C 语法 之 流程控制
- ldd可执行程序时返回not a dynamic executable
- java操作对比两个字符串,将差异数据提取出来
- C# 切分图片
- BZOJ1058或洛谷1110 [ZJOI2007]报表统计
- Web API 2 使用Entity Framework Part 1.
- 手把手教你如何用 OpenCV + Python 实现人脸识别
- 数组操作方法(包括es5)
- redis 在 php 中的应用(Server[ 服务器] 篇)
- Android 判断是否能真正上网
- HDUOJ----旋转的二进制
热门文章
- jquery获取文档高度和窗口高度汇总
- Codeforces #564div2 E1(记忆化搜索)
- FusionCharts的类 - 实例功能
- zabbix agent 配置
- 《springcloud 一》搭建注册中心,服务提供者,服务消费者
- 【异常】SQL Server blocked access to STATEMENT OpenRowset/OpenDatasource
- C#、VSTO讀取Excel類
- git-gui:使用终端打开以后出现错误提示 Spell checking is unavable
- .net core 的跨域
- SpringBoot热部署的两种方式